WebThe Dumeril’s Boa is a large, heavy bodied, ground snake found exclusively on the island of Madagascar. They are typically 4-6 feet long, but can reach up to 7 feet, and can weigh up to 20 lbs. WebRosy boas are thick-bodied slow-moving snakes of deserts and rocky shrublands in southern California. They are most often active at night, and in the evening. Rosy boas are commonly found crossing roads at night or underneath rocks in late winter and spring. Recently, two species have been identified. The only way to tell them apart is by range. WebJun 6, 2024 · The Rosy Boa is a small constrictor snake found in the deserts of the southwestern United States. These snakes are small, but skilled hunters that prey on small rodents and other reptiles. Rosy Boas are easy to spot because of their namesake rosy-pink colors!
